logo Debian Debian Debian-France Debian-Facile Debian-fr.org Forum-Debian.fr Debian ? Communautés logo inclusivité

Debian-facile

Bienvenue sur Debian-Facile, site d'aide pour les nouveaux utilisateurs de Debian.

Vous n'êtes pas identifié(e).

#1 16-04-2015 14:18:49

micoudic
Membre
Inscription : 16-04-2015

[Résolu] XFCE4 - récupérer les lanceurs

Bonjour,
Je viens d'installer la dernière version de debian avec XFCE. Actuellement, je travaille avec Salix, également avec XFCE. Je me suis créé une grande quantité de lanceurs avec la Salix, et j'aimerai récupérer ces lanceurs dans la débian sans avoir à tout re-saisir. J'ai recopié la totalité du dossier "/home/moi/.config/xfce4" de la Salix dans son équivalent débian, mais je me retrouve avec un bureau sans tableau de bord, ce qui fait un peu juste pour travailler normalement smile
Connaissez-vous la manip pour rapatrier ces lanceur dans la débian ?
Je vous remercie.

Dernière modification par micoudic (25-04-2015 09:55:00)

Hors ligne

#2 16-04-2015 15:15:24

sogal
Black Metal Modo
Lieu : Nord Isère
Distrib. : openSUSE Leap 42.3
Noyau : Linux 4.4.76
(G)UI : GNOME
Inscription : 09-05-2013
Site Web

Re : [Résolu] XFCE4 - récupérer les lanceurs

Salut,
En théorie la copie que tu as fait devrait recopier ton profil Xfce. N'y a-til pas un problème de droit sur les fichiers copiés ?

1485418338.png Hello IT ! Have you tried turning it off and on again ?

Hors ligne

#3 16-04-2015 15:16:56

Anonyme-8
Invité

Re : [Résolu] XFCE4 - récupérer les lanceurs

peut être en recopiant dans /home/user/.config/xfce4/xfconf/xfce-perchannel-xml/xfce4-panel.xml

#4 17-04-2015 09:31:34

micoudic
Membre
Inscription : 16-04-2015

Re : [Résolu] XFCE4 - récupérer les lanceurs

Merci pour vos réponses.
En fait, j'ai déjà réalisé cette manipulation, mais c'était avec une ancienne version de xfce (la 3 peut-être ? ). Je me souviens que j'avais recopié le dossier complet dans mon nouveau home, mais il y avait également un autre fichier, une sorte de table des lanceurs qui était stocké ailleurs, mais je ne me souviens plus quel était ce fichier ni où il était. Par ailleurs, il y a eu de gros changement dans XFCE avec la V4.

@ Anonyme-8 : Oui j'ai pris soin de bien recopier également ce dossier et son contenu.
@ sogal : Les droits sont les mêmes, les noms et id utilisateurs sont identiques dans les deux distributions.

Hors ligne

#5 17-04-2015 09:43:26

sogal
Black Metal Modo
Lieu : Nord Isère
Distrib. : openSUSE Leap 42.3
Noyau : Linux 4.4.76
(G)UI : GNOME
Inscription : 09-05-2013
Site Web

Re : [Résolu] XFCE4 - récupérer les lanceurs

Salut,
XFCE étant très respectueux des standard freedesktop, tout devrait être stocké dans les dossiers de config de ton espace utilisateur, c'est étrange.
Tu as regardé par hasard dans /usr/share/xfceXX ou un truc du genre ?

1485418338.png Hello IT ! Have you tried turning it off and on again ?

Hors ligne

#6 17-04-2015 11:01:49

seb95deMLO
Invité

Re : [Résolu] XFCE4 - récupérer les lanceurs

Queslle version sur salix? Car je sais que mon xfce4.10 debian et mon xfce4.12 0linux ne se melange pas.

#7 17-04-2015 12:02:53

nikau
Banni(e)
Distrib. : jessie
Noyau : 3.16.0-4-amd64
(G)UI : Xfce 4.10.1
Inscription : 19-10-2011

Re : [Résolu] XFCE4 - récupérer les lanceurs

seb95deMLO a écrit :

Queslle version sur salix? Car je sais que mon xfce4.10 debian et mon xfce4.12 0linux ne se melange pas.



avec un changement de version xfce4, c'est vrai qu'une copie de .config peut résulter sur un bureau vide, essaie toutefois 

xfwm4 --replace &



sinon tu n'as tout de même pas des centaines de lanceurs dans le panel ?  avec un dock (installer docky) , un  <<glissé>> avec curseur/souris depuis la liste des applications

xfce4-appfinder

c'est très rapide et tu gagnes ton temps.

pour les duplications de systèmes sur ordis déjà anciens,  je procède ainsi (Debian xfce4 d'emblée) et en 2 minutes, tous les lanceurs sont dans le dock.

Hors ligne

#8 17-04-2015 15:23:23

yoshi
Membre
Lieu : Normandie
Distrib. : LMDE 6 Faye
Noyau : 6.6.5-1-liquorix-amd64
(G)UI : Cinnamon 5.8.4
Inscription : 05-03-2014

Re : [Résolu] XFCE4 - récupérer les lanceurs

seb95deMLO a écrit :

Queslle version sur salix? Car je sais que mon xfce4.10 debian et mon xfce4.12 0linux ne se melange pas.



Salix est basé sur la Slackware 14.1 stable. XFCE est en version 4.10 (4.10.2 exactement).


Desktop 1: SKP P21. Gigabyte B550M DS3H. AMD Ryzen 9 3900 @ 3,1 Ghz. Kingston FURY 64 Gb DDR4-3200. Sapphire Radeon Pulse RX 6700 XT 12Gb.
Laptop: Acer Aspire E5-573G. Intel Core i3-4005U @ 1,7 Ghz. Intel Haswell-ULT Integrated Graphics
Desktop 2: HP Compaq 6000 Pro Intel Core2 Quad Q8400 @ 2,6 Ghz. 6Gb ddr3. Geforce GT 710

Hors ligne

#9 23-04-2015 20:27:19

micoudic
Membre
Inscription : 16-04-2015

Re : [Résolu] XFCE4 - récupérer les lanceurs

Bonjour à tous,

Ca y est, j'arrive a récupérer mes lanceurs smile

Cela fait un bout de temps que je galère à recopier mes fichiers pour xfce4. J'avais déjà fait cette manip, et j'ai retrouvé les notes que j'avais prises alors. Mais rien ne voulait fonctionner.
Soit j'ai pas tout noté, soit cela a changé.
En tous cas, voici ce qu'il faut faire :
NE PAS SUPPRIMER le dossier

/home/user/.config/xfce4

ni supprimer le contenu de ce dossier. Il faut impérativement travailler par modification des fichiers existants.
Rajouter dans le dossier

/home/user/.config/xfce4/panel

les dossiers à récupérer de la salix dans la debian, puis, avec un éditeur de texte, modifier (ajouter) les instructions comprises dans l'ancien fichier

/home/user/.config/xfce4/xfconf/xfce-perchannel-xml/xfce4-panel.xml

en prenant bien garde d'insérer les titres au bon endroit : dans mon cas, sous la rubrique

<property name="panel-0" type="empty">

, puis les références aux différents lanceurs en dessous.

Je n'ai pas encore tout rapatrié. Il me faut également adapter certains lanceurs (par ex : remplacer "terminal" par "xfce4-terminal" partout où il est défini.

Hors ligne

#10 23-04-2015 21:39:07

sogal
Black Metal Modo
Lieu : Nord Isère
Distrib. : openSUSE Leap 42.3
Noyau : Linux 4.4.76
(G)UI : GNOME
Inscription : 09-05-2013
Site Web

Re : [Résolu] XFCE4 - récupérer les lanceurs

Bonsoir,
Super! merci pour ton retour. smile

PS : Penses à modifier le sujet du post en [RESOLU] wink

1485418338.png Hello IT ! Have you tried turning it off and on again ?

Hors ligne

#11 25-04-2015 15:18:26

micoudic
Membre
Inscription : 16-04-2015

Re : [Résolu] XFCE4 - récupérer les lanceurs

Petite précision : On ne peut pas mettre à jour le fichier

/home/user/.config/xfce4/xfconf/xfce-perchannel-xml/xfce4-panel.xml

pendant que "user" est signé dans sa session. (On peut le mettre à jour, tout se passe bien, mais au redémarrage de la session, toutes les modifs ont disparu)  sad

Hors ligne

#12 03-05-2015 21:41:03

micoudic
Membre
Inscription : 16-04-2015

Re : [Résolu] XFCE4 - récupérer les lanceurs

Bonjour,
Après divers problèmes, j'ai ré-installé la debian sur une autre partition. J'ai re-tenté la manip pour récupérer les lanceurs: Tout s'est très bien passé cette fois.
J'avais fait cette manip de Salix 13.37 à Salix 14, sans problème.
J'ai vraiment galéré pour refaire la même chose de Salix 14 à jessie. Mais de Jessie à une autre Jessie, tout baigne. Il y a quelque chose qui m'échappe.
Enfin, le plus important est de savoir que OUI, c'est possible de récupérer les lanceur par simple recopie, mais dans certaines conditions seulement ?

Hors ligne

#13 02-08-2015 12:50:44

dropforged
Membre
Lieu : Nord Isère
Distrib. : Debian Buster
Noyau : Linux 4.19.0-9-amd64
(G)UI : XFCE
Inscription : 08-03-2015
Site Web

Re : [Résolu] XFCE4 - récupérer les lanceurs

Je me permet de poster sur ce topic qui est "Résolu", mais j'ai étais confronté au même problème et j'ai trouver une solution très simple pour "cloner" un bureau XFCE y compris ces lanceurs.

Comme l'a fait remarqué micoudic

pendant que "user" est signé dans sa session. (On peut le mettre à jour, tout se passe bien, mais au redémarrage de la session, toutes les modifs ont disparu)  sad



La solution, lancer un CD live et copier/coller le dossier /home/utilisateur/.config/xfce4 à "cloner".

Ainsi la session n'est pas en cours et ça fonctionne impeccable big_smile

Hors ligne

Pied de page des forums